Amber Leavis
Staff Veterinarian DVM
Dr. Amber Leavis knew from a young age that she wanted to be a veterinarian. Her childhood was spent being surrounded by cats and dogs, as well as small mammals (hamsters and rabbits) and birds. In college, she honed her clinical skills and education by working as a technician at a local veterinary hospital. Dr. Leavis received her Bachelor of Science degree in Animal and Veterinary Sciences, with a minor in Business, from the University of Rhode Island and received her Doctor of Veterinary Medicine from Tufts Cummings School of Veterinary Medicine. Dr. Leavis went on to complete a small animal community medicine internship at Angell at Nashoba in Massachusetts. She moved down to South Carolina and worked for a year and a half at another clinic before joining the VCA family. Her clinical interests include Internal Medicine, Soft Tissue Surgery, and Dermatology. Dr. Leavis manages a mini zoo of her own at home with a Lab/Beagle mix named Dakota, two cockatiels (Belle and Gaston), and fish. In her free time, she enjoys baking, reading, photography, and gardening!
